Immunoblot Analysis of Effector Proteins in PDTX Tumors Treated with TAK-733

This figure presents the immunoblot analysis of effector proteins from patient-derived tumor xenograft (PDTX) mice treated with TAK-733 compared to vehicle controls. The proteins evaluated include phosphorylated S6 (pS6), AKT (pAKT), ERK (pERK), along with α-tubulin as a loading control. The analysis aims to elucidate the response to TAK-733 treatment concerning BRAF status, specifically focusing on tumors harboring the V600E mutation. The findings may offer insights into the mechanistic action of TAK-733 in tumor biology.
